At present, domestic building for low strength rebar are80percent of335Mpa level reinforced, namely20MnSi II grade steel, the application of highly strength rebar of400Mpa is less, it is a big miss distance compared with the developed countries.20MnSi II rebar the major disadvantage is low strength, and unsatisfactory bending performance, the strain rate decreased by20%-29%. Secondly, in construction of the dense reinforcement affect concrete pouring, and do not have the anti-seismic performance. And III reinforced high performance level, included high strength, excellent plasticity, good welding performance, the cold bending property, saving steel and the convenient construction, etc. For these purposes, our country enhanced the research and development of400Mpa rebar, lighted for reaching in the level of international as soon as possible, and speed up the upgrading of building steel, popularize application of400MPa level rebar.HRB400rebar is based on20MnSi rebar added micro alloying element niobium, titanium, vanadium, using of the precipitation strengthening function of its carbide and carbon compounds increased strength of steel, content the requirements of HRB400rebar. But in recent years, along with the rising price of vanadium, make the production cost increasing. In order to optimize the structure of products, reduce production cost of HRB400rebar, niobium micro alloying production of HRB400rebar were studied on by the factory.The test results show that, on the basic of the original process route of VN micro alloying, using of original production equipment, optimized the scheme of the Second-Cooling-Area water distribution of continuous casting, low multiple inspection qualified rate increased obviously; In the researching process of going through water cooling system in rolling, obtained a result that the best water pressure is about1.1MPa of the Nb micro alloying of HRB400rebar production.
